Cocoa-inspired cosmetics

Refrain from popping choccies directly into your mouth and replicate the addictive taste on your pout with a flavoured lip balm or gloss. A sheer formulation is more flattering than a matte brown shade of lipstick.

"An intense chocolate shade on the lips can be draining if you are pale," warns creator of Famous Make-Up, Sue Moxley.

If you're not convinced about wallowing in heady chocolate aromas, try translating those dark desires through your eyes.

"Chocolate eyes are sexy this spring," Sue says. "For daytime, use a paler shade of chocolate eyeshadow and blend carefully.

"For evening, vamp it up and go for full-on dark chocolate in the socket and blend around and under the eye. Add black liner across the top lid, keeping it close to the lashes, and then smudge it in with a cotton bud. Finish with lashings of black mascara."

Sweet treat-ments

With all the feel-good properties cocoa boasts, it's little wonder women are craving the brown stuff in their beauty regimes. Even spas are adding a sprinkling of chocolate over their treatment lists to meet chocoholic demands.

"Pretty much everyone loves chocolate," explains Cynthia Chua, founder of Ministry of Waxing who's introduced a 'Wild Berry Chocolate Wax'.

"There's both a naughtiness and a luxury angle associated with it. For women in particular, chocolate treatments let them feel they are allowing themselves something delicious without piling on the pounds."

Re-create the aromatic spa feeling at home by lathering up with choc-inspired products like bubble baths, moisturisers, and hair masks. Lock the bathroom door and melt away your woes with cocoa's mood boosting powers.

The Nutri Centre's nutritional therapist Shona Wilkinson says: "Endomorphins and flavonoids are natural compounds found in cocoa and can be beneficial to improve mood, raise libido, and promote a healthy heart."
